There is also the older version of Tokheim nozzles that have the word “Tokheim” cast into the side of them. I’m not sure if they were used on 34’s, but they probably would fit the time frame. If I remember correctly, I think there were two versions. One with a hook (for visibles) and one without. I have several, and I can check tomorrow for pics, but I’m sorry, they are NFS.

Maybe someone on here knows the timeframe for the nozzles I’m talking about a little better than me. But they are cool nozzles, nonetheless.
